Causal relationship between C-reactive protein and ischemic stroke caused by atherosclerosis: A Mendelian randomization study.

Abstract

OBJECTIVES

This study investigates the association between C-reactive protein (CRP) and ischemic stroke caused by large artery atherosclerosis (LAA).

METHODS

Five Mendelian Randomization (MR) methodologies were used for two-sample analyses: Inverse Variance Weighting (IVW), MR-Egger regression, Weighted Median (WM), Simple Mode, and Weighted Mode. CRP exposure data were obtained from aggregated summary statistics from a meta-analysis of genome-wide association studies (GWAS) in individuals of European ancestry (n = 343,524; UK Biobank). Stroke data were used as the outcome, with specific dataset details for relevant subtypes (cases = 40,585, controls = 406,111).

RESULTS

In the CRP GWAS dataset, selected single nucleotide polymorphisms (SNPs) as instrumental variables (IVs) showed genome-wide significance and a causal relationship with CRP, particularly in relation to LAA stroke. IVW indicated a robust causal connection between CRP and LAA stroke (Beta = 0.151, SE = 0.055, P = 0.006). The WM approach supported this relationship (Beta = 0.176, SE = 0.082, P = 0.033). However, MR-Egger regression suggested a potential absence of a causal link (Beta = 0.098, SE = 0.077, P = 0.206), with minimal influence from horizontal pleiotropy (Intercept = 0.0029; P = 0.317). The Simple mode found no significant association (Beta = 0.046, SE = 0.217, P = 0.834), while the Weighted mode revealed a significant causal association (Beta = 0.138, SE = 0.059, P = 0.020) between CRP and LAA stroke.

CONCLUSIONS

MR analysis provides evidence for a potential causal relationship between CRP and an increased risk of LAA stroke.

摘要

目的

本研究旨在探讨 C 反应蛋白(CRP)与大动脉粥样硬化(LAA)所致缺血性脑卒中之间的关联。

方法

采用两样本 Mendelian Randomization(MR)分析方法,包括逆方差加权(Inverse Variance Weighting,IVW)、MR-Egger 回归、加权中位数(Weighted Median,WM)、简单模式(Simple Mode)和加权模式(Weighted Mode)。CRP 暴露数据来源于欧洲血统个体全基因组关联研究(genome-wide association studies,GWAS)汇总的汇总统计数据(n = 343524;英国生物银行)。卒中数据作为结局,特定亚组(病例 = 40585,对照 = 406111)的数据集详情。

结果

在 CRP GWAS 数据集中,选择单核苷酸多态性(single nucleotide polymorphisms,SNPs)作为工具变量(instrumental variables,IVs),结果显示与 CRP 呈全基因组显著关联,并与 CRP 呈因果关系,特别是与 LAA 卒中相关。IVW 表明 CRP 与 LAA 卒中之间存在稳健的因果关系(Beta = 0.151,SE = 0.055,P = 0.006)。WM 方法支持这种关系(Beta = 0.176,SE = 0.082,P = 0.033)。然而,MR-Egger 回归提示可能不存在因果关系(Beta = 0.098,SE = 0.077,P = 0.206),水平多效性的影响很小(截距 = 0.0029;P = 0.317)。简单模式未发现显著关联(Beta = 0.046,SE = 0.217,P = 0.834),而加权模式则显示 CRP 与 LAA 卒中之间存在显著的因果关联(Beta = 0.138,SE = 0.059,P = 0.020)。

结论

MR 分析提供了 CRP 与 LAA 卒中风险增加之间存在潜在因果关系的证据。
